Very useful but he's missing quite a few:
- 47 Labs do a Miyabi mono cartridge
- Koetsu do several at different price points
- Ikeda does a quite superlative mono cartridge (would love to get my hands on one)
- Phasemation do one (the mono-PP)
- He misses a few Miyajimas (Kotetu, Premium and Spirit models)
It always surprised me that Peter Qvortrop - a record collector par excellence - doesn't do a mono version of the Io. That would be interesting.
There's a great discussion on Audiogone where Jonathan Carr of Lyra (who apprenticed with Ikeda) sets out his view of mono as a cartridge maker. Essentially he's gone down the route of fancy stylus profiles for maximum data retrieval but I would suggest that's better for later mono .. early in my opinion is better with spherical.
